Dandruff

Dry and flaky skin in the scalp is called dandruff. It makes the scalp itchy, and oily-looking flakes of dead skin can be seen on the hair, neck, and shoulder. It is not a serious condition and can be controlled by using shampoos that contain zinc pyrithione, tar, selenium sulfide, or Ketoconazole.
